Jasper de Jonge, Specialist in Strategic Project at the City of Tampere, presented the city’s pioneering WeGenerate Digitwin. The project empowers residents, businesses, and entrepreneurs by integrating real-time traffic flows, pedestrian data, seasonal weather insights, and augmented reality simulations into a dynamic digital model of the city.
Designed with sustainability, safety, and inclusivity in mind, Tampere’s digital twin is positioned as a powerful tool for co-creating future urban scenarios, strengthening resilience, and supporting smart city decision-making.
The conference also featured cutting-edge presentations from European experts on the use of digital twins in climate-neutral planning, coastal conservation, and human-centric urban design, underlining the growing role of virtual technologies in shaping the cities of tomorrow.
